The House rebuked the president's Iraq strategy with a non-binding resoluton that passed 246-182.

Among the micromanaging members, House Intelligence Committee Chairman Silvestre Reyes doesn't know Shiite from Sunni.

According to CNN: When asked by CQ National Security Editor Jeff Stein whether al Qaeda
is one or the other of the two major branches of Islam — Sunni or
Shiite — Reyes answered "they are probably both," then ventured
"Predominantly — probably Shiite."

That is wrong. Al Qaeda was founded by Osama bin Laden as a Sunni organization and views Shiites as heretics.

Reyes
could also not answer questions put by Stein about Hezbollah, a Shiite
group on the U.S. list of terrorist organizations that is based in
Southern Lebanon.
